Types of Funding Available for Education in Canada

1. Federal Grants

The Canadian government provides a range of funding programs to support education initiatives, such as:
  • Canada Student Grants: Offer financial assistance to low- and middle-income students.
  • Research Grants: Through organizations like the Social Sciences and Humanities Research Council (SSHRC) and Natural Sciences and Engineering Research Council (NSERC).
  • Innovation Funding: Programs like the Canada Foundation for Innovation (CFI) focus on enhancing educational infrastructure and research capabilities.

2. Provincial and Territorial Grants

Each province and territory offers grants tailored to regional needs. Examples include:
  • Ontario Trillium Foundation (OTF): Supports educational projects with a focus on innovation and community impact.
  • Ministère de l’Éducation du Québec: Provides funding for programs targeting early childhood and post-secondary education.
  • British Columbia’s Community Gaming Grants: Helps fund school programs and extracurricular activities.

3. Scholarships and Bursaries

Various public and private organizations offer scholarships and bursaries to students at different levels. Key examples include:
  • Canada Graduate Scholarships (CGS): Supports master’s and doctoral students in research-intensive programs.
  • Indigenous Bursaries Search Tool: Connects Indigenous students with funding opportunities.
  • Corporate-Sponsored Scholarships: Provided by companies like RBC, TD, and others for specific fields of study.

4. Grants for Teachers and Educational Institutions

Programs that support educators and institutions include:
  • Teachers Learning and Leadership Program (TLLP): Funds professional development for educators in Ontario.
  • Campus Sustainability Grants: Help post-secondary institutions implement green initiatives and sustainable practices.

5. Research and Innovation Grants

These grants support studies and pilot projects aimed at improving education outcomes. Examples include:
  • SSHRC Insight Grants: Fund research in the social sciences and humanities.
  • NSERC PromoScience: Supports projects that engage youth in science and technology.

How to Apply for Grants and Funding

Securing funding for educational initiatives requires strategic planning and a compelling application. Follow these steps:

1. Identify Relevant Programs

Research funding opportunities that align with your goals. Use resources such as:
  • Government of Canada’s education funding page
  • Provincial education ministries
  • Online tools like hellodarwin.com for grant searches

2. Understand Eligibility Requirements

Ensure you meet the specific criteria for the grant, such as:
  • Applicant Type: Individual students, teachers, institutions, or non-profits.
  • Purpose: Research, infrastructure, scholarships, or community programs.
  • Location: Some grants are region-specific.

3. Prepare a Detailed Proposal

A strong proposal should include:
  • Objectives: Clearly state the purpose and goals of the initiative.
  • Budget Plan: Provide a breakdown of expenses and justify the funding amount.
  • Impact Assessment: Highlight the expected benefits for students, educators, or the community.
  • Supporting Documentation: Include letters of support, institutional endorsements, or academic references.

4. Submit and Follow Up

Adhere to deadlines and submission guidelines. Be proactive in following up with the funding organization for updates or feedback.

Common Challenges and Tips for Success

  • Navigating Complex Requirements: Break down the application process and seek guidance from grant advisors.
  • Competing for Limited Funds: Focus on the unique aspects of your proposal to make it stand out.
  • Managing Multiple Applications: Stay organized with a timeline and checklist for each application.
  • Dealing with Rejections: Learn from feedback and reapply with improved proposals.
